Window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ide for Homeowners

Windows act as one of the most important elements of any home, providing natural light, ventilation, and a connection to the outdoors world. Beyond their visual appeal, windows play an important role in energy performance, security, and general comfort. Gradually, nevertheless, even the highest-quality windows begin to reveal indications of wear and degeneration. When that happens, property owners deal with the important decision of whether to repair existing windows or purchase a total replacement. This guide explores everything homeowner need to understand about window replacement, from recognizing the signs that replacement is essential to selecting the best windows and comprehending the installation procedure.

Why Window Replacement Matters

The choice to change windows extends far beyond simple cosmetic improvements. Aging or damaged windows can significantly impact a home's energy effectiveness, resulting in higher utility expenses during severe weather seasons. According to energy studies, windows can represent up to 30% of domestic heating and cooling energy usage when they are improperly insulated ordrafty. This implies that old, single-pane windows or designs with failing seals can cost property owners numerous additional dollars each year in energy expenses.

Beyond energy concerns, degraded windows can compromise home security and safety. Weak frames, split glass, or malfunctioning locks make homes more vulnerable to trespassers and accidents. Furthermore, foggy or discolored windows that have lost their seals lower natural light and lessen the general visual appeal of interior areas. For house owners planning to offer their residential or commercial property, upgraded windows work as a strong selling point that possible purchasers recognize and value.

Indications It's Time for Window Replacement

Acknowledging when windows require replacement needs attention to several essential indicators. Drafts are frequently the most obvious indication, especially when property owners feel cold air leaking through closed windows even throughout mild weather. Condensation in between window panes suggests failed seals, which suggests the insulating gas has actually escaped and the window's energy effectiveness has been compromised.

Physical damage presents another clear signal that replacement is essential.  read more  consists of broken or broken glass, decayed or deformed frames, problem opening and closing windows, and relentless moisture accumulation around the window location. Property owners must also consider replacement if their windows are more than 20 years old, as building requirements and window innovation have actually enhanced drastically in recent decades. Even if existing windows appear functional, the energy cost savings from modern-day alternatives typically validate the investment.

Kinds Of Replacement Windows

When picking replacement windows, homeowners experience many alternatives in regards to materials, styles, and glazing technologies. The following table compares the most common window types to assist guide decision-making:

Window TypeFrame MaterialTypical LifespanEnergy EfficiencyUpkeep Level
Double-hungVinyl, wood, fiberglass20-40 yearsExcellent to outstandingLow to moderate
SashVinyl, wood, aluminum20-35 yearsExceptionalLow
MovingVinyl, aluminum20-30 yearsExcellentLow
Bay and bowWood, vinyl20-40 yearsGoodModerate
PictureVinyl, wood, fiberglass25-50 yearsExcellentLow

Vinyl windows have actually ended up being significantly popular due to their price, low maintenance requirements, and decent energy performance. Wood frames use remarkable aesthetic appeal and excellent insulation properties but need more maintenance to prevent rot and decay. Fiberglass frames represent a premium option, integrating the toughness of aluminum with the thermal performance of wood at a moderate upkeep level.

Understanding the Installation Process

Window replacement generally follows one of 2 approaches: full-frame replacement or pocket replacement. Full-frame replacement involves removing the whole existing window, including the frame and trim, down to the rough opening. This method enables bigger windows and is required when existing frames are damaged or when homeowners wish to alter the window size or style. Pocket replacement, likewise called insert replacement, maintains the existing frame and connects the new window within the existing opening. This method is less intrusive, much faster, and more economical however limitations sizing choices.

The setup process typically begins with precise measurements of existing openings. Expert installers evaluate the condition of current frames and suggest the suitable replacement technique. On installation day, protective coverings protect floor covering and furnishings while workers eliminate old windows, prepare openings, andSecurely mount new units. The process normally concludes with insulation application, trim reinstallation, and comprehensive clean-up.

Picking the Right Windows for Your Home

Picking windows requires balancing multiple elements consisting of environment, architectural style, spending plan, and efficiency priorities. In colder climates, triple-pane windows with low-E finishes and gas fills supply superior insulation. Warmer areas gain from windows with solar control finishes that decrease heat gain while preserving noticeable light transmission. Homeowners in seaside locations must focus on corrosion-resistant frames and impact-rated glass that endures extreme weather.

Energy Star accreditation uses trustworthy guidance for picking windows that fulfill stringent energy performance requirements suitable for specific geographic regions. Beyond performance rankings, house owners should think about the architectural consistency of their choice. Standard homes typically suit wood or wood-clad windows with divided lites, while modern styles normally pair well with sleek vinyl or fiberglass frames with very little detailing.

Warranty coverage deserves cautious attention throughout the selection process. Quality windows typically feature glass service warranties covering 15 to 20 years or longer, with frame and hardware guarantees often matching or exceeding this period. Completely understanding guarantee terms, including what is covered and any needed upkeep for validity, prevents future problems.

Expense Considerations and Return on Investment

Window replacement represents a considerable home improvement financial investment, with expenses differing commonly based on window size, material quality, glazing choices, and installation complexity. On average, house owners can expect to pay in between ₤ 300 and ₤ 700 per window for quality vinyl systems, while premium wood or fiberglass windows might range from ₤ 500 to ₤ 1,200 or more per system. Full-frame installation includes around ₤ 100 to ₤ 300 per window compared to pocket replacement approaches.

In spite of the in advance expenses, window replacement normally delivers strong return on financial investment through lowered energy costs, increased home worth, and enhanced convenience. Studies regularly reveal that property owners recoup between 60 and 75% of window replacement expenses at resale, making it among the more financially sensible home enhancement tasks available.


Often Asked Questions About Window Replacement

The length of time does the window replacement procedure take?

The duration depends upon the variety of windows and the installation method picked. For a typical home with 10 to 15 windows, pocket replacements normally total within one to two days. Full-frame replacements need additional time, typically 2 to 3 days for the exact same number of windows, due to the increased intricacy of removing existing frames and bring back wall surfaces.

Can I set up replacement windows myself, or should I employ an expert?

While skilled DIYers with building and construction skills can successfully install pocket replacement windows, professional setup is highly advised for most property owners. Expert installers bring correct licensing, insurance coverage, and expertise that guarantees correct fitting, correct sealing, and warranty security. Inappropriate installation can void producer service warranties and result in air leaks, water seepage, and operational issues.

What is the very best season to change windows?

Window replacement can take place effectively in any season, though lots of homeowners choose spring or fall when weather is moderate. Summer and winter season installations present extra challenges but stay totally practical with proper techniques.Professional installers can apply interior plastic barriers and work efficiently to lessen temperature level disruption to homes during extreme weather condition months.

Are triple-pane windows worth the additional cost?

Triple-pane windows normally cost 10 to 15% more than comparable double-pane alternatives. In areas with severe temperatures or high energy expenses, the extra investment often pays for itself through energy savings within 10 to 15 years. For temperate environments with moderate heating and cooling demands, double-pane windows with low-E coverings generally offer adequate performance at a lower cost.
